Hail Storm Damage Repair in Claresholm
Severe hail can cause significant damage to a roofing system, even when the roof does not immediately appear to be leaking. Hail impacts can bruise shingles, remove protective granules, damage vents, and weaken areas of the roof that may eventually allow water to enter.
If your Claresholm property has recently experienced a hailstorm, having the roof inspected is an important first step.
Highwood Roofing can assess your roof for signs of hail storm damage, including:
- Hail impacts and bruising
- Granule loss
- Cracked or damaged shingles
- Damaged vents and accessories
- Exposed roofing materials
- Wind-related shingle damage
- Areas vulnerable to future leaks
Identifying storm damage early can help you understand what needs to be repaired before additional weather causes further deterioration.
Roof Restoration vs. Roof Replacement
Roof restoration can be a practical option when the underlying roofing system is still in reasonable condition but certain areas have begun to deteriorate.
Depending on the condition of your roof, restoration or repair may involve replacing damaged shingles, correcting flashing, addressing leaks, repairing localized storm damage, and improving areas that have become vulnerable to moisture.
A complete replacement may make more sense when the roofing system has reached the end of its service life or has widespread deterioration.

When Should You Have Your Roof Inspected?
Some roofing problems are easy to notice, such as a missing shingle or an active leak. Others can remain hidden until significant damage has already occurred.
Consider scheduling a roof inspection if you notice:
- Water stains on ceilings or walls
- Shingles scattered around your property
- Missing or visibly damaged shingles
- Excessive granules in your gutters
- Cracked or curling shingles
- Damaged flashing
- A leak following a storm
- Visible hail impacts
- Drafts or moisture concerns in the attic
- An aging roof that has not been inspected recently
A professional assessment can help determine whether the issue requires a simple repair, more extensive restoration, or eventual replacement.
Roof Repair After Wind and Storm Damage
Hail is not the only weather-related threat to roofing in southern Alberta. Strong winds can lift or loosen shingles, damage flashing, and create openings where moisture can enter.
Storm damage is sometimes difficult to identify from the ground. A roof may look relatively normal while individual shingles or roofing components have already been compromised.
After a significant storm, an inspection can help identify damage before it develops into a leak or larger structural concern.

Can hail damage a roof even if there is no leak?
Yes. Hail can damage shingles and roofing components without creating an immediate opening for water. Some damage may not become apparent until later, which is why an inspection following a significant hailstorm can be worthwhile.
